Merge tag 'hyperv-fixes-signed-20230804'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/hyperv/linux
Pull hyperv fixes from Wei Liu: - Fix a bug in a python script for Hyper-V (Ani Sinha) - Workaround a bug in Hyper-V when IBT is enabled (Michael Kelley) - Fix an issue parsing MP table when Linux runs in VTL2 (Saurabh Sengar) - Several cleanup patches (Nischala Yelchuri, Kameron Carr, YueHaibing, ZhiHu) * tag 'hyperv-fixes-signed-20230804'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/hyperv/linux: Drivers: hv: vmbus: Remove unused extern declaration vmbus_ontimer() x86/hyperv: add noop functions to x86_init mpparse functions vmbus_testing: fix wrong python syntax for integer value comparison x86/hyperv: fix a warning in mshyperv.h x86/hyperv: Disable IBT when hypercall page lacks ENDBR instruction x86/hyperv: Improve code for referencing hyperv_pcpu_input_arg Drivers: hv: Change hv_free_hyperv_page() to take void * argument
